A paper by David F Carrageta, Bárbara Guerra-Carvalho et al. entitled "Animal models of male reproductive ageing to study testosterone production and spermatogenesis" has just been published in "Reviews in Endocrine and Metabolic Disorders" journal. In this paper, the authors discuss the characteristics, advantages and disadvantages of the most used animal models for the study of reproductive ageing, particularly spermatogenesis and testosterone production. A paper by Luís Crisóstomo et al. entitled "Testicular “inherited metabolic memory” of ancestral high-fat diet is associated with sperm sncRNA content" has just been published in the "Biomedicines" journal. In this paper the authors identify differently expressed small non-coding RNA sequences in sperm of mice fed with control or high-fat diet, and in their progeny. The results suggest a role of sperm RNAs in the epigenetic inheritance of ancestral exposure to high-fat diets. Congratulations!
